
On July 27th, The 24 Hour Plays: Little Rock returns to the stage at Argenta Contemporary Theatre for an unforgettable night of creativity, collaboration, and community.
In just 24 Hours, over 75 local actors, writers, directors, and crew members come together to create six original short plays, from blank page to full performance. The result is electric, one-of-a-kind theatre!
This year, The 24 Hour Plays: Little Rock celebrates and supports Arkansas Enterprises for the Developmentally Disabled. AEDD is a cornerstone of our community, dedicated to helping individuals with intellectual and developmental disabilities lead independent and fulfilling lives.
AEDD provides essential vocational training and real-world work opportunities, partnering with local businesses to help participants earn wages and gain professional experience. Their holistic approach ensures every individual thrives, offering everything from on-site behavioral health services to specialized speech, physical, and occupational therapies. All net proceeds from The 24 Hour Plays: Little Rock directly benefit AEDD’s vital programs, including "AEDD in the Rock," a community-based initiative that provides individuals with disabilities the chance to shine in the performing arts — proving that creativity knows no bounds.
